递归查询设计

来源:2-2 Hash分区表

xiaowu9

2017-12-01

在三级分销中,建立分销关系蛮简单的,标记用户的发展用户ID即可。后期统计业务数据就麻烦了,需要使用递归查询,如果查询用户一二三级团队数就要递归三次。如果查询一二三级团队消费金额的话性能就会出问题了,请问如何解决?

写回答

1回答

sqlercn

2017-12-01

目前MySQL中比较好的方法是分别统计各个级别的然后于union 在一起

0
1
xiaowu9
如果用户中途要改自己上级,就很麻烦,所有关系都要同步!
2017-12-01
共1条回复

高性能可扩展MySQL数据库设计及架构优化 电商项目

从基础设计入手,设计高性能可扩展的千万级数据库架构

1155 学习 · 166 问题

查看课程